TURN-208: Gatevale turnstile counters at the Merrow Field pilot double-count when a rotation reverses mid-cycle. Attendance totals drift roughly 2% high per event. The debounce window fix is implemented, reviewed by Ilsa, and soak-tested across two simulated match days without drift. Ready for your cut; the candidate build is identified below.

trace token, tagag-tafog: htk6_5ed18c

- [ ] Step 7: Archive cold storage buckets (Glacierline tier). Confirm both ceremony witnesses are present, verify bucket manifests match the Oxbow ledger, then seal the archive key shares. Plugin authors may observe but not handle shares. Once sealed, the archive index itself is encrypted and can only be reopened with the passphrase below.

vault phrase of badup-hahig = tamael-aldael-kelmir-istael-fenok-istwyn-tamius-jorath-oliion

Filed for the weekly sync: the nightly search reindex on Querrel keeps dying at 03:14 because staging is pointed at the prod index credential, which expired. Classic copy-paste from when Tomas cloned the box. Fix is easy but someone with vault access needs to do it. On the staging reindex host, replace the stale entry in .env with the following line:

vault entry, yahaf-tagug: LEDGER_TOKEN20=884d77d1a8b98aa4edfb